The MAX148/MAX149 10-bit data-acquisition systems combine an 8-channel multiplexer, high-bandwidth track/hold, and serial interface with high conversion speed and low power consumption. They operate from a single 2.7V to 5.25V supply, and sample to 133ksps. Both devices' analog inputs are software configurable for unipolar/bipolar and single-ended/differential operation. The 4-wire serial interface connects directly to SPI(TM)/QSPI(TM) and MICROWIRE(TM) devices without external logic. A serial-strobe output allows direct connection toTMS320-family digital signal processors. The MAX148/ MAX149 use either the internal clock or an external serial-interface clock to perform successive-approximation analog-to-digital conversions. The MAX149 has an internal 2.5V reference, while theMAX148 requires an external reference. Both parts have a reference-buffer amplifier with a -1.5% voltage-adjustment range. These devices provide a hard-wired SHDN pin and asoftware-selectable power-down, and can be programmed to automatically shut down at the end of a con-version. Accessing the serial interface automatically powers up the MAX148/MAX149, and the quick turn-ontime allows them to be shut down between all conversions. This technique can cut supply current to under60uA at reduced sampling rates. The MAX148/MAX149 are available in a 20-pin DIP and a20-pin SSOP. For 4-channel versions of these devices, see theMAX1248/MAX1249 data sheet.
